Forest Products Commission

The Forest Products Commission (FPC) was established in November 2000. Its role is to develop, market and sustainably manage the State’s high quality renewable timber resources for the people of Western Australia. The Commission works with industry to deliver economic and social benefits in the regions.

FPC operates under an Act of parliament as a Statutory Authority. This enables the agency to engage in commercial forestry activities in State-owned native forests and plantations.

Old growth forests are protected by law. Our management of the forests has been recognised in achieving Australian Forestry Standard (AFS) accreditation. AFS is a recognised international certification for sustainable forest management. This accreditation is based on rigorous independent auditing and is recognition of FPC’s ongoing commitment to sustainable forest practices.
